December 23rd, 2010

ben - mugshot
  • renee_c

Thank Your Secret Santa


We're hearing that some gifts may be arriving. Why don't you head over here and express your love and gratitude to your awesome Secret Santa? And show us those pics of your fabulous gifts! 

Have a very happy holidays, everyone! 
Peace and carrots! xx